
You are here

Environmental justice

Trudeau’s Shakespearean demise: tragedy or comedy?

October 18, 2019 - Left JAB by John Bell

A vote for Singh and the NDP is a blow against bigotry

October 14, 2019 - Left JAB by John Bell

Election 2019: Vote NDP, fight for the planet

October 8, 2019

Climate strikes and beyond - How we win

October 5, 2019 - Brian Champ

500,000 march in Montreal: Quebec and Climate Justice

October 2, 2019 - Chantal Sundaram

A million climate justice protesters can't be wrong: system change now!

September 30, 2019 - Carolyn Egan

Why labour should support the climate strike

September 4, 2019 - Carolyn Egan

Jakarta is sinking: casualty of climate change

August 29, 2019 - John Bell

How Climate Strikes can win

August 28, 2019 - Brian Champ

Extinction Rebellion activist speaks: troublemakers can change the world

August 27, 2019

Australian pol reveals void at capitalism’s heart: Human survival is just “annoying”

August 17, 2019

Tory plan to cash in on climate chaos

August 17, 2019 - John Bell

Toxic tar sands mine approved “in the public interest”

August 15, 2019 - Bradley Hughes

Protestors demand green debate

August 12, 2019 - Janine Carter

Why Marx matters: capitalism and the Metabolic Rift

August 10, 2019 - Brian Champ

Outside agitators and traitors: big oil's war on environmentalists

August 7, 2019 - John Bell

Stop the killing of social leaders in Colombia

August 2, 2019 - Gustavo Monteiro

Preventing climate chaos: ideas that can win

July 30, 2019 - Martin Empson

Liberal hypocrisy on climate emergency

June 19, 2019 - John Bell

Canada’s Genocide

June 3, 2019 - John Bell


Featured Event



Visit our YouTube Channel for more videos: Our Youtube Channel
Visit our UStream Channel for live videos: Our Ustream Channel